logo

DeepSeek接入个人知识库:速度与智能的双重革命

作者:菠萝爱吃肉2025.09.25 15:29浏览量:0

简介:本文深度解析DeepSeek接入个人知识库的技术原理、性能优势及实际应用场景,通过实测数据与代码示例,揭示其如何以毫秒级响应重构知识服务生态。

一、技术架构革新:从通用模型到个性化智能中枢

DeepSeek接入个人知识库的技术突破,本质上是大模型与私有数据的高效融合。传统AI工具依赖公开数据集训练,而DeepSeek通过向量数据库与检索增强生成(RAG)技术,将用户私有文档、代码库、业务数据等结构化/非结构化信息转化为可检索的语义向量。

1.1 核心架构拆解

  • 向量嵌入层:采用BERT、SimCSE等模型将文本转化为高维向量,支持中英文混合场景的语义理解。例如,用户上传的《2023年销售报告》会被拆解为多个语义块,每个块生成1024维向量。
  • 索引优化引擎:基于FAISS(Facebook AI Similarity Search)构建的近似最近邻搜索(ANN)系统,可在亿级向量中实现毫秒级检索。实测显示,10万条文档的检索延迟稳定在15ms以内。
  • 动态生成模块:检索结果与DeepSeek原生大模型结合,通过注意力机制动态调整回答内容。例如,当用户询问”Q3财报中的毛利率变化原因”时,系统会优先调用财报中的相关段落,再结合行业基准生成分析。

1.2 性能实测数据

在200GB企业知识库的测试中,DeepSeek展现出以下优势:

  • 首字响应时间:平均82ms(传统方案需300-500ms)
  • 回答准确率:结构化数据查询达98.7%,复杂推理场景达91.2%
  • 资源占用:GPU利用率降低40%,支持单机部署千亿参数模型

二、速度革命:毫秒级响应背后的技术密码

DeepSeek的惊人速度源于三大技术突破:

2.1 混合检索架构

系统采用”粗选-精排”两阶段检索:

  1. # 伪代码示例:混合检索流程
  2. def hybrid_search(query, knowledge_base):
  3. # 阶段1:向量相似度粗选(Top 100)
  4. candidates = faiss_index.search(query_embedding, 100)
  5. # 阶段2:BM25+语义精排(Top 10)
  6. ranked = reranker.rank(query, candidates)
  7. # 阶段3:模型生成回答
  8. response = deepseek_model.generate(query, ranked_contexts)
  9. return response

该架构使检索效率提升3-5倍,同时保证95%以上的召回率。

2.2 动态缓存机制

系统自动识别高频查询,将结果缓存至Redis集群。实测显示,20%的常见问题可由缓存直接响应,平均延迟降低至35ms。

2.3 模型压缩技术

通过量化感知训练(QAT)将FP16模型压缩至INT8精度,推理速度提升2.3倍,且精度损失<1%。这在边缘设备部署时尤为重要。

三、应用场景革命:从个人到企业的全链路赋能

3.1 个人知识管理

  • 学术研究:自动关联论文中的公式推导、实验数据,支持跨文献对比分析。例如,输入”比较Transformer与LSTM在NLP任务中的表现”,系统会调取10篇顶会论文的关键结论。
  • 编程辅助:接入代码仓库后,可实现上下文感知的代码补全。测试显示,Java代码生成准确率达89%,错误定位准确率92%。

3.2 企业知识服务

  • 智能客服:某电商平台接入后,客服响应时间从2分钟降至8秒,解决率从65%提升至91%。
  • 合规审查:金融企业通过上传监管文件,实现合同条款的自动合规检查,误报率降低至3%以下。

3.3 开发者工具链

提供完整的API接口与SDK,支持快速集成:

  1. // Java SDK示例
  2. DeepSeekClient client = new DeepSeekClient("API_KEY");
  3. KnowledgeBase kb = client.createKnowledgeBase("my_docs");
  4. kb.uploadDocuments(new File[]{doc1, doc2});
  5. String answer = client.query(
  6. "解释量子计算的基本原理",
  7. new QueryOptions().setTopK(5).setTemperature(0.7)
  8. );

四、实施建议与最佳实践

4.1 数据准备要点

  • 结构化清洗:使用正则表达式或NLP工具提取关键字段(如日期、金额)
  • 分块策略:建议每块300-500字,保持语义完整性
  • 元数据标注:添加文档类型、来源、时效性等标签提升检索精度

4.2 性能优化方案

  • 冷启动优化:预加载高频文档向量至内存
  • 分布式部署:对于超大规模知识库(>1TB),采用Sharding+Replication架构
  • 持续更新机制:建立每日增量更新管道,确保知识时效性

4.3 安全合规措施

  • 数据加密:传输使用TLS 1.3,存储采用AES-256
  • 访问控制:基于RBAC模型的细粒度权限管理
  • 审计日志:完整记录查询行为,满足等保2.0要求

五、未来展望:重构知识工作范式

DeepSeek接入个人知识库的技术演进,预示着知识服务将进入”即时智能”时代。据Gartner预测,到2026年,75%的企业知识工作将由AI增强系统完成。开发者应重点关注:

  1. 多模态知识融合:结合图像、音频等非文本数据
  2. 实时知识更新:通过流式处理支持秒级知识迭代
  3. 个性化适配:根据用户行为动态调整回答风格

这场由DeepSeek引领的革命,不仅改变了知识获取的方式,更在重新定义人类与信息的交互范式。对于追求效率的开发者与企业而言,这无疑是一个必须把握的战略机遇。

相关文章推荐

发表评论